After the secular girl group Destiny’s Child disbanded, Michelle Williams shifted to Gospel music by releasing her solo inspirational album Heart to Yours (2002). She released her second project Do You Know two years later and stayed in the Gospel lane. But in 2008, Michelle went back to the secular side with a R&B/Pop/Dance album. […]
